Preparation
- Cover a large, flat plate or cookie sheet with waxed paper and set aside.
- Slice the butter into 8-10 pieces and add it to a large bowl.
- Add the Funfetti cake mix, sugar, flour, and vanilla extract to the bowl.
- Using a fork, work the butter into the flour and cake mix until thoroughly combined and resembles smooth cookie dough. Use hands to combine if needed.
- Add 1-2 tablespoons of milk or water if the dough is too dry.
- Mix in rainbow sprinkles.
- Scoop 1 tablespoon of the truffle batter and roll it into a ball using your palms. Place the truffle balls on the prepared baking sheet.
- Freeze the truffles for 10 minutes before coating them with white chocolate.
- Melt white chocolate wafers in a microwave-safe bowl, microwaving for 30 seconds, stirring, then microwaving for another 20-30 seconds. Stir until fully melted.
- Dip each dough ball into the melted white chocolate and place it on the prepared plate. Top with sprinkles immediately.
- Place truffles in the fridge for at least 20-30 minutes or until the white chocolate coating hardens.
- Store truffles in the fridge for up to 7-10 days. Serve and enjoy.
